256, FFF. ṯt-Amulet (Girdle of Isis).
POSITION:
Neck; <just below centre of right clavicle; wire round neck.> Right side, second group :/<(>i.e., FFF, KK, GGG. and HHH).
DIMENSIONS:
L. 6.5 cents. W. 3.0 cents. Wire 70 cents (total length)
DESCRIPTION:
Ṯt-amulet of red jasper, attached by gold (beaten) wire to neck of King.
First and right hand side amulet of second group (FFF. KK. GGG and HHH) of
amulets without wrappings of the neck of the King :/<(>see diagram).
Has eyelet for attachment at top.
REMARKS:
This group of amulets reach down to the upper part of/<below> the clavicles.
